Courtney Wayment prize money

Courtney Wayment has been paid $15,500 by the Diamond League, which ranks 698th of the 2,112 athletes the series has paid. It came from eight paid finishes in the women's 3000 m steeplechase, the best of them 4th.

The Diamond League pays by finishing place and nothing else. A published card sets what first through eighth is worth, the same figure in every discipline at that meeting, and ninth pays nothing.

How does the Diamond League decide what Courtney Wayment gets paid?

Entirely by where she finishes. The series publishes one rate card a season and applies it to every discipline at every meeting, so a place is worth the same in the women's 3000 m steeplechase as it is in the shot put on the same afternoon. Eight places are paid and ninth pays nothing. There is no bonus for a record and no share of a gate.
